Python
Java
PHP
IOS
Android
Nodejs
JavaScript
Html5
Windows
Ubuntu
Linux
使用量化约束导出 Ord(forall a.Ord a => Ord (f a))
通过量化的约束我可以得出Eq A f 正好 但是 当我尝试导出 Ord A f 时 它失败了 我不明白当约束类具有超类时如何使用量化约束 我如何得出Ord A f 以及其他有超类的类 gt newtype A f A f Int gt de
Haskell
typeclass
derivedclass
quantifiedconstraints
如何从范围内的约束族派生类型类实例?
edit 我又跟进了一个具体问题 https stackoverflow com questions 70088443 how can i use a constraint family thats in scope to prove in
Haskell
constraints
gadt
existentialtype
quantifiedconstraints
haskell——n 级约束? (或者,monad 转换器和 Data.Suitable)
我正在尝试写一些看起来类似于 rank 2 types 的东西 但是为了约束 或者 也许假设改变是不正确的 gt 在 rank 2 types 的定义中 gt 是有意义的 如果您想出更好的术语 请编辑问题 setup 首先 Suitable
Haskell
typeclass
typeconstraints
quantifiedconstraints
量化约束与(封闭)类型族
我正在尝试使用这篇博文的方法是在不悬而未决的情况下获取更高级的数据Identity简单情况的函子与量化约束推导一起 LANGUAGE TypeFamilies LANGUAGE QuantifiedConstraints Standalon
Haskell
typefamilies
deriving
derivingvia
quantifiedconstraints
为什么使用 QuantifiedConstraints 指定类型类的子类还需要子类的实例?
我正在尝试多种无标签编码Free LANGUAGE PolyKinds LANGUAGE TypeSynonymInstances LANGUAGE TypeFamilies LANGUAGE Rank2Types LANGUAGE Fle
Haskell
quantifiedconstraints